#b45161 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b45161 is composed of 70.6% red, 31.8% green and 38%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 55% magenta, 46.1% yellow and 29.4% black. It has a hue angle of 350.3 degrees, a saturation of 39.8% and a lightness of 51.2%. #b45161 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a2c2 with #690000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

#b45161 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b45161 has RGB values of R:180, G:81, B:97 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.55, Y:0.46,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 11817313.

Shades and Tints of #b45161
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040202 is the darkest color, while #fbf5f6 is the lightest one.
